Verónica Mar (b. 1979, Granada) is a Spanish sculptor, artist and creative director based in Madrid. She holds a BA in Fine Arts from the University of Barcelona (2005) and a BA in Interior Design from Eina School (2004). Her work is not about representing what we see, but revealing what we feel — what vibrates beneath the surface of form. Inspired by Kandinsky's idea of art as a spiritual act, she creates sculptures, paintings and design pieces that speak a silent language of energy, balance and inner presence, shaping steel, brass, aluminium and acrylic stone into ascending organic forms. Since 2014 she has exhibited at art fairs and galleries in London, Shanghai, Barcelona, Madrid, Miami and New York, including Rossana Orlandi (Milan), Les Ateliers Courbet (New York), Mint (London), and The Wolfsonian Museum (Miami). Her SOUL Sculpture bench (2011) and Autumn Leaf swing (2012) won international awards.
